Ferrari "failed" on 2016 F1 targets - Marchionne

Ferrari president Sergio Marchionne has admitted that the Italian team has 'failed' with its ambitions this year, as he set sights on a recovery in 2017. Marchionne declared before the start of the season that he wanted the team to win from the very first race ahead of a full assault on the world championship. But despite leading the early stages of the Australian Grand Prix, Ferrari fell short there and has failed to win in the meantime. With Mercedes on course for another world championship double, Marchionne conceded that he had given up on hope of Ferrari achieving all he wanted it to do this season.
